黑狐家游戏

集中式和分布式调度的区别与联系,集中式调度与分布式调度,差异与融合之路

欧气 1 0

本文目录导读:

  1. 集中式调度与分布式调度的定义
  2. 集中式调度与分布式调度的区别
  3. 集中式调度与分布式调度的联系

随着信息技术的飞速发展,调度技术在众多领域扮演着至关重要的角色,调度作为系统运行的核心,主要解决任务分配、资源分配和任务执行等问题,在分布式系统中,调度技术尤为重要,本文将深入探讨集中式调度与分布式调度的区别与联系,旨在为读者提供一个全面、深入的了解。

集中式和分布式调度的区别与联系,集中式调度与分布式调度,差异与融合之路

图片来源于网络,如有侵权联系删除

集中式调度与分布式调度的定义

1、集中式调度

集中式调度是指在一个统一的调度中心进行任务分配、资源分配和任务执行等操作的调度方式,在这种方式下,调度中心负责收集整个系统的资源信息,并根据任务需求和资源情况,将任务分配给相应的资源执行。

2、分布式调度

分布式调度是指在多个节点上进行任务分配、资源分配和任务执行等操作的调度方式,在这种方式下,每个节点都具备一定的调度能力,可以根据本地资源情况和任务需求,独立地进行任务分配和资源分配。

集中式调度与分布式调度的区别

1、调度中心

集中式调度具有统一的调度中心,负责整个系统的任务分配和资源分配,而分布式调度没有统一的调度中心,每个节点都具备一定的调度能力。

2、资源分配

集中式调度在资源分配上相对简单,调度中心可以全面了解整个系统的资源情况,从而进行合理分配,而分布式调度在资源分配上相对复杂,每个节点需要根据本地资源情况和任务需求进行独立分配。

集中式和分布式调度的区别与联系,集中式调度与分布式调度,差异与融合之路

图片来源于网络,如有侵权联系删除

3、可扩展性

集中式调度在可扩展性上存在一定限制,随着系统规模的扩大,调度中心的压力也会增加,而分布式调度在可扩展性上具有优势,可以通过增加节点来提高系统性能。

4、鲁棒性

集中式调度在鲁棒性上相对较弱,一旦调度中心出现故障,整个系统可能会受到影响,而分布式调度在鲁棒性上具有优势,即使部分节点出现故障,其他节点仍能正常工作。

5、实时性

集中式调度在实时性上可能存在一定延迟,因为所有任务都需要经过调度中心进行处理,而分布式调度在实时性上具有优势,每个节点可以独立处理任务,从而提高系统的响应速度。

集中式调度与分布式调度的联系

1、调度目标

无论是集中式调度还是分布式调度,其最终目标都是为了提高系统的性能和资源利用率。

集中式和分布式调度的区别与联系,集中式调度与分布式调度,差异与融合之路

图片来源于网络,如有侵权联系删除

2、调度算法

集中式调度和分布式调度都可以采用相同的调度算法,如轮转调度、优先级调度等。

3、调度策略

集中式调度和分布式调度可以采用相同的调度策略,如负载均衡、任务迁移等。

集中式调度与分布式调度在系统架构、资源分配、可扩展性、鲁棒性和实时性等方面存在一定的差异,它们在调度目标、调度算法和调度策略等方面具有联系,在实际应用中,可以根据具体需求选择合适的调度方式,以实现系统的高效运行,随着技术的不断发展,集中式调度与分布式调度之间的融合将更加紧密,为我国信息技术的发展提供有力支撑。

标签: #集中式和分布式调度的区别

黑狐家游戏
  • 评论列表

留言评论